@charset "gb2312";
/* 全局CSS定义 */
body {font-family:"微软雅黑";margin:0;padding:0;font-size:14px; background:#c0c0c0 url(../images/bg.jpg) repeat-y center; color:#484848;}
p,div,form,img,ul,ol,li,dl,dt,dd {margin:0;padding:0;border:0;}
ul,ol,li{list-style:none;}
h1,h2,h3,h4,h5,h6 {margin:0;padding:0;}
table,li,tr,th,br{font-size:14px; font-family:"微软雅黑";}
img{ display:block;}
/* 链接颜色 */
a{ text-decoration:none; color:#484848;}
a:hover{ text-decoration:none; color:#C00;}

.fl{ float:left;}
.fr{ float:right;}
.tc{ text-align:center;}
.tr{ text-align:right;}
.cl{ clear:both;}
.pt_01{ padding-top:15px;}
.pt_02{ padding-top:5px;}
.pt_03{ padding-top:12px;}
.pt_04{ padding:12px;}
.mt_01{ margin-top:20px;}
/* nav */
.nav{ width:100%; color:#fff; text-align:center; font-size:12px; height:30px; line-height:30px; font-family:"宋体"; background:url(../images/bg01.jpg) repeat-y center;}
.nav a{ color:#fff;}

.bg01{ width:100%; background:url(../images/title_01.jpg) no-repeat center top; height:437px;}
.bg02{ width:100%; background:url(../images/title_02.jpg) no-repeat center top; height:60px;}
.bg02 div{ margin:0px auto; width:900px;}
.bg02 div a{ float:left; line-height:46px; color:#f8b831; font-size:20px; font-weight:bold; text-align:center;}
.bg02 div a.b01{ width:197px;}
.bg02 div a.b02{ width:172px;}
.bg02 div a:hover{ color:#C00;}

.box_01{ margin:0px auto; width:1200px; font-size:16px; color:#f8b831; line-height:26px;}
.box_01 a{ color:#f8b831;}
.box_01 a:hover{ color:#C00;}
.box_01 .a01{ padding:105px 0 0 810px; width:380px;}
.box_01 .a02{ padding:12px 0 0 850px; width:340px;}
.box_02{ float:left; width:1176px; height:450px;position:relative;overflow:hidden; }
.box_02 .left{ position:absolute; top:0px; right:50px; width:42px; height:43px; background:url(../images/left.jpg) 0px 0px no-repeat; z-index:9999;}
.box_02 .right{ position:absolute; top:0px; right:0px; width:42px; height:43px; background:url(../images/right.jpg) 0px 0px no-repeat; z-index:9999;}
.box_02 .box{position:absolute; top:0px; left:0px; width:1176px; height:450px; z-index:99;}
.box_02 .box01{ float:left; width:565px;}
.box_02 .box02{ float:left; width:611px;}
.box_02 .box02 dl{ float:left; width:590px; padding-left:10px; height:185px;}
.box_02 .box02 dl dt{ font-size:24px; color:#02869d; font-weight:bold;}
.box_02 .box02 dl dd{ padding-top:15px; font-size:18px; line-height:24px;}
.box_02 .box02 ul{ float:left; width:611px;}
.box_02 .box02 ul li{ float:left; width:205px;}
.box_02 .box02 ul li.cc{ width:200px;}
.box_03{  height:450px;position:absolute;  overflow: hidden; }

.fs_01{ font-size:20px; color:#e90000; text-align:center;}
.fs_01 a{ color:#e90000;}
.fs_01 a:hover{ color:#C00;}
.fs_02{ font-size:16px; color:#000; line-height:22px; padding-bottom:4px;}
.fs_02 a{ color:#000;}
.fs_02 a:hover{ color:#C00;}
.fs_03{ line-height:24px; padding:8px 0 4px 0; color:#238ba2;}
.fs_03 a{ color:#238ba2;}
.fs_03 a:hover{ color:#C00;}
.fs_04{ font-size:18px; font-weight:bold; color:#238ba2; line-height:24px; padding-top:10px;}
.fs_04 a{ color:#238ba2;}
.fs_04 a:hover{ color:#C00;}
.fs_05{ font-size:12px; line-height:22px; padding-top:5px;}

.l26{ line-height:26px;}
.l20{ line-height:20px;}

.list_01{ float:left; width:1190px; padding:12px 0 10px 12px;}
.list_01 li{ float:left; width:390px; height:255px; margin:0 3px 3px 0; font-size:16px; color:#FFF; text-align:center; position:relative;}
.list_01 li .bg{ position:absolute; top:210px; left:0px; width:390px; height:45px; background:#000; cursor:pointer;opacity:0.6;-moz-opacity:0.6;filter:alpha(opacity=60); z-index:999;}
.list_01 li .tit{ position:absolute; top:210px; left:0px; width:90px; padding-right:5px; height:45px; background:url(../images/title_09.png) 0px 0px no-repeat; line-height:45px; z-index:9999;}
*html .list_01 li .tit{ _bancground-image:none; _filterprogid:DXImageTransform.Microsoft.AlphaImageLoader(src="title_09.png" ,sizingMethod="noscale");}
.list_01 li a{ color:#FFF;}
.list_01 li a:hover{ color:#C00;}
.list_01 li .text{ position:absolute; top:210px; left:95px; width:295px; line-height:45px; z-index:9999;}

.tab4{ float:left; width:1084px; height:75px;}
.tab4 li{ float:left; margin-right:6px; text-align:center;}
.tab4 li a{ display:block; text-decoration:none; width:210px; line-height:43px; font-size:24px; color:#FFF; font-weight:bold; text-align:center; }
.tab4 li a:hover{ color:#FFF; text-decoration:none;}
.tab4 li a.a_01, .tab4 li a.a_02, .tab4 li a.a_03, .tab4 li a.a_04, .tab4 li a.a_05{ background:#ffa800;}
.tab4 li a.a_1, .tab4 li a.a_2, .tab4 li a.a_3, .tab4 li a.a_4, .tab4 li a.a_5{ background:#02869d;}

.tab5{ float:left; width:1084px; height:75px;}
.tab5 li{ float:left; margin-right:6px; text-align:center;}
.tab5 li a{ display:block; text-decoration:none; width:210px; line-height:43px; font-size:24px; color:#FFF; font-weight:bold; text-align:center; }
.tab5 li a:hover{ color:#FFF; text-decoration:none;}
.tab5 li a.a_01, .tab5 li a.a_02, .tab5 li a.a_03, .tab5 li a.a_04, .tab5 li a.a_05{ background:#ffa800;}
.tab5 li a.a_1, .tab5 li a.a_2, .tab5 li a.a_3, .tab5 li a.a_4, .tab5 li a.a_5{ background:#02869d;}


.wrapper { width: 640px; float:left;}
        /* qqshop focus */#focus { width: 640px; height: 320px; overflow: hidden; position: relative; }
        #focus ul { height: 320px; position: absolute; }
        #focus ul li { float: left; width: 640px; height: 320px; overflow: hidden; position: relative; background: #000; }
        #focus ul li div { position: absolute; overflow: hidden; }
        #focus .btnBg { position: absolute; width: 640px; height: 20px; left: 0; bottom: 0; background: #000; }
        #focus .btn { position: absolute; width: 685px; height: 10px; padding: 5px 10px 5px 10px; right: 0; bottom: 5px; text-align: right; }
        #focus .btn span { display: inline-block; _display: inline; _zoom: 1; width: 25px; height: 10px; _font-size: 0; margin-left: 5px; cursor: pointer; background: #fff; }
        #focus .btn span.on { background: #fff; }
        #focus .preNext { width: 45px; height: 100px; position: absolute; top: 110px; background: url(../images/sprite.png) no-repeat 0 0; cursor: pointer; }
        #focus .pre { left: 0; }
        #focus .next { right: 0; background-position: right top; }



/* footer */

#footer{ width:100%; line-height:25px; font-family:"宋体"; font-size:12px; color:#000; text-align:center; padding:40px 0;}
#footer a{ color:#000}
#footer p{ text-align:center; font-family:"宋体"; font-size:12px; }
#footer address{ font-style:normal; text-align:center; color:#000; font-family:"宋体"; font-size:12px;}